I had a member suggest adding a power bar to my Apex to use for equipment that is constantly on, therefore freeing up an outlet for other uses. If anyone does this what is a good quality power bar to purchase.

No need to plug stuff in to the apex outlets that aren't actually being controlled by the apex.

As for power bars, I use a fairly heavy duty shop-type with an on off switch and a built in circuit breaker&surge protector.

You could also get extension cord splitters to combine equipment on the apex, if possible. For instance if you are running 2 lights you could us the splitter to run both lights off one outlet. Surge protector is probably cheaper in the long run. I like the surge protectors that have individual switches for each outlet, this Way equipment can still be shutdown easily.
